Dungiven
Address
Priory Lane, Dungiven, County Londonderry, BT47 4UHTelephone
+44 (0) 28 9082 3207Price
FreeType
Type:
Abbey / Priory
Augustinian priory with a 15th-century tomb of Cooey-na-Gall, an O'Cahan chief, who died in 1385.

FreeBelfast
Address
34 Bedford Street, Belfast, County Antrim, BT2 7FFTelephone
+44 (0) 28 9033 4400Type
Type:
Music Hall
Built in 1862, the Ulster Hall has been entertaining the citizens of Belfast for more than 150 years. Fondly known as Belfast's 'home of music' the venue was completely restored in 2009.
